mirror of
https://gitlab.freedesktop.org/gstreamer/gstreamer.git
synced 2024-12-23 08:46:40 +00:00
bf8c785fb0
Original commit message from CVS: Documentation updates. All standard library objects and standard elements are documented. Modified some of the elements to more accuratly report about their arguments so the documentation builds more reasonable output. Added aviencoder and jpegencoder elements (not working yet)
48 lines
1,017 B
Text
48 lines
1,017 B
Text
<!-- ##### SECTION Title ##### -->
|
|
GstDiskSrc
|
|
|
|
<!-- ##### SECTION Short_Description ##### -->
|
|
Synchronous read from a file (disksrc)
|
|
|
|
<!-- ##### SECTION Long_Description ##### -->
|
|
<para>
|
|
Synchonously read buffers from a file. If you need asynchronous reading
|
|
with seeking capabilities use a <classname>GstAsynDiskSrc</classname> instead.
|
|
|
|
</para>
|
|
|
|
<!-- ##### SECTION See_Also ##### -->
|
|
<para>
|
|
|
|
</para>
|
|
|
|
<!-- ##### ENUM GstDiskSrcFlags ##### -->
|
|
<para>
|
|
<informaltable pgwide=1 frame="none" role="enum">
|
|
<tgroup cols="2"><colspec colwidth="2*"><colspec colwidth="8*">
|
|
<tbody>
|
|
<row>
|
|
<entry>GST_DISKSRC_OPEN</entry>
|
|
<entry>the disksrc is open for reading</entry>
|
|
</row>
|
|
|
|
</tbody></tgroup></informaltable>
|
|
|
|
</para>
|
|
|
|
|
|
<!-- ##### ARG GstDiskSrc:location ##### -->
|
|
<para>
|
|
Specify the location of the file to read.
|
|
</para>
|
|
|
|
<!-- ##### ARG GstDiskSrc:bytesperread ##### -->
|
|
<para>
|
|
Specify how many bytes to read at a time.
|
|
</para>
|
|
|
|
<!-- ##### ARG GstDiskSrc:offset ##### -->
|
|
<para>
|
|
Get the current offset in the file.
|
|
</para>
|
|
|